Chad Hansen

Timothy Chad Hansen (born January 18, 1995) is an American football wide receiver for the Houston Texans of the National Football League (NFL). He played college football at California, and was drafted by the New York Jets in the fourth round of the 2017 NFL Draft.

Early years

Hansen attended Moorpark High School in Moorpark, California. As a senior, he had 49 receptions for 882 yards and 12 touchdowns.

College career

Hansen's lone scholarship offer to play college football was from Idaho State University.[1][2] As a true freshman at Idaho State in 2013, he played in 11 games and had 45 receptions for 501 yards and three touchdowns.[3] After the season, he transferred to the University of California, Berkeley to join the football team as a walk-on.[4] After sitting out 2014, due to transfer rules, Hansen had 19 receptions for 249 yards and a touchdown over 10 games in 2015. As a junior in 2016, he was named first team All-Pac-12 after recording 92 receptions for 1,249 yards and 11 touchdowns in 10 games.[5] After the season, he decided to forgo his senior year and enter the 2017 NFL Draft.[6][7]

New York Jets

Hansen was drafted by the New York Jets in the fourth round (141st overall) of the 2017 NFL Draft.[9][10][11]

On September 1, 2018, Hansen was waived by the Jets.[12]

New England Patriots

On September 2, 2018, Hansen was claimed off waivers by the New England Patriots.[13] He was waived on September 10, 2018.[14]

Tennessee Titans

On October 2, 2018, Hansen was signed to the Tennessee Titans' practice squad.[15] He was released on October 15, 2018.[16]

Denver Broncos

On November 13, 2018, Hansen was signed to the Denver Broncos practice squad.[17] On January 2, 2019, Hansen was re-signed to reserve/future contract.[18] On May 2, 2019, the Broncos waived Hansen.[19]

New Orleans Saints

On June 11, 2019, Hansen was signed by the New Orleans Saints.[20] He was waived on July 25, 2019.[21]

Houston Texans

On July 26, 2019, Hansen was claimed off waivers by the Houston Texans.[22] The Texans waived him on August 31 during final roster cuts.[23] On September 25, 2019, Hansen was signed to the practice squad.[24] He signed a reserve/future contract with the Texans on January 13, 2020.[25]
